The 2-day workshops were a mix of short talks from professionals about architecture and engineering, and design workshops to allow the students to put what they’ve learnt into action. In teams of 2-5 they designed a pavilion to be part of Clerkenwell Design Week in Central London. Utilising the skills they learnt during the weekend they produced conceptual sketches, plans, sections and a 3D physical model to explain their ideas. The culmination of the weekend saw the students present their ideas to a positive and constructive panel of judges!
The winning team members will see their design used as the basis for the real pavilion which you and all workshop participants are invited to help build in May 2018.

This is the fourth year of Scale Rule design-and-build pavilion projects, following on from three previous projects in London (2017; 2016; 2015) and one in Birmingham (2017)

Construction
The selected pavilion design was used as the basis for the pavilion built (and planted!) by a fantastically dedicated team of designers, tutors, volunteers and students to open for Clerkenwell Design Week 2018!
